SYNOPSIS
Encompassing a span of 31 years, this book is a chronicle of the bizarre, curious, and sometimes startling criminal events that took place in New Jersey between 1922 and 1952, a period many call the "Noir" era. The American public is fascinated by tales of love, betrayal, and murder, and these stories include all these elements, and much more.
